Unveiling The Biocatalytic Aromatizing Activity Of Monoamine Oxidases Mao-N And 6-Hdno: Development Of Chennoenzymatic Cascades For The Synthesis Of Pyrroles

ACS Catalysis(2017)

摘要
A chemoenzymatic cascade process for the sustainable production of pyrroles has been developed. Pyrroles were synthesized by exploiting the previously unexplored aromatizing activity of monoamine oxidase enzymes (MAO-N and 6-HDNO). MAO-N/6-HDNO whole cell biocatalysts are able to convert 3-pyrrolines into pyrroles under mild conditions and in high yields. Moreover, MAO-N can work in combination with the ruthenium Grubbs catalyst, leading to the synthesis of pyrroles from diallylamines/-anilines in a one-pot cascade metathesis aromatization sequence.
